titleOfInvention |
Catalyzed decomposition of peroxide intermediates resulting from the autoxidation of acrolein or methacrolein |
abstract |
A process for the preparation of acrylic acid or methacrylic acid by the ruthenium and/or osmium catalyzed conversion of peroxide (peroxy) intermediate compounds, derived from the autoxidation of acrolein or methacrolein, to the corresponding alpha , beta -unsaturated carboxylic acid, particularly the conversion of permethacrylic acid and methacrolein monopermethacrylate to methacrylic acid. |
